IceCure Secures China NMPA Approval for ProSense Cryoablation System

IceCure Medical ICCM recently secured regulatory approval from China's National Medical Products Administration (“NMPA”) for its ProSense cryoablation system and associated cryoprobes. The clearance marks a key milestone in the company's international expansion strategy and allows the technology to be commercially marketed in China.

The approval broadens IceCure's addressable market by opening access to one of the world's largest healthcare markets. While commercial execution and adoption will remain the next key factors to watch, the regulatory win strengthens the company's global commercialization footprint and creates a new avenue for potential long-term revenue growth.

More on the News

The NMPA granted Class III medical device approval for IceCure's ProSense system and its associated cryoprobes, enabling the company to market the platform in China in line with the approved registration. The clearance represents an important regulatory milestone for ICCM as it expands the number of markets where its flagship cryoablation technology is authorized for commercialization. Management noted that the approval reinforces the company's global regulatory standing and advances its efforts to expand patient access to minimally invasive tumor treatment options.

ProSense is IceCure's flagship liquid-nitrogen-based cryoablation system designed to destroy tumors by freezing them, offering a minimally invasive alternative to surgical tumor removal. The platform is used to treat both benign and cancerous tumors and is primarily focused on breast, kidney, bone and lung cancer applications. The procedure is performed through a relatively short intervention, making it an attractive treatment option in appropriate clinical settings.

The latest approval adds to ProSense's growing international regulatory footprint, with the system already cleared or approved for multiple indications across the United States, Europe and Asia. The expanded geographic reach is expected to support the company's commercialization efforts by increasing access to healthcare providers and patients across key global markets. As IceCure builds on this broader regulatory base, the focus is likely to shift toward driving market adoption and expanding the use of ProSense in approved indications.

Industry Prospects Favoring the Market

Per a report by Verified Market Reports, the global cryoablation for cancer market size was valued at $3.5 billion in 2024 and is projected to register a CAGR of 6.1% from 2026 to 2033, reaching $5.8 billion by 2033.

The cryoablation market is experiencing strong growth, fueled by the rising incidence of cancer, an aging population and innovations in cryotherapy. A major driver of this expansion is the increasing adoption of cryoablation for smaller tumors, as it offers fewer side effects compared to traditional treatments.

Other News

Recently, IceCure Medical entered into an exclusive distribution agreement with Scovas Medical to commercialize its ProSense cryoablation system in the Netherlands for breast cancer and interventional oncology applications. The initial agreement is expected to support market development, physician education and broader clinical access in a market with strong interventional radiology expertise and growing demand for minimally invasive cancer treatments, potentially strengthening the company's commercial presence in Europe.
